A Phase IV Interventional Study to Assess the Disease-Modifying Effect of Long-Term Treatment With Tildrakizumab in Adult Patients With Moderate-To-Severe Plaque Psoriasis (MODIFY)

The purpose of this study is to evaluate the psoriasis disease control over time in participants who had received Tildrakizumab for at least the last 5 years and have discontinued it and to describe blood and skin inflammatory biomarkers and its correlation disease relapse.

Percentage of Participants Who Experienced Psoriasis Relapse
时间窗: Baseline up to Week 96/ End of study (EOS)
Psoriasis Area and Severity Index (PASI) is a combination of the intensity of psoriasis, assessed by the erythema (reddening), induration (plaque thickness) and scaling on a scale range from 0 (no symptoms) to 4 (very marked), together with the percentage (%) of the area affected, rated on a scale from 0 (0%) to 6 (90-100%). PASI scoring is performed at four body areas, the head, arms, trunk, and legs. The total PASI score ranges from 0 (no psoriasis) to 72 (the most severe disease). Relapse is defined using the following thresholds: PASI greater than (\>) 3 (participants who had a PASI lesser than or equal to \[\<=\] 3 at baseline); PASI \> 5 (participants who had a PASI \<= 5 at baseline); DLQI \> 5 (participants who had a DLQI \<= 5 at baseline); Initiation of any topical drug/medication for psoriasis; Initiation of any systemic therapy for psoriasis (biologic or non-biologic).
